| Insider | Price | Amount | Total Value | Remaining Holdings | Date | Form 4 |
| Officer | $200.30 | 400 | $80,120.00 | 206,334 | 2025-10-22 | Filing |
| Officer | $198.61 | 200 | $39,722.00 | 206,734 | 2025-10-22 | Filing |
| Officer | $197.58 | 3,300 | $652,014.00 | 206,934 | 2025-10-22 | Filing |
| Officer | $196.92 | 3,800 | $748,296.00 | 210,234 | 2025-10-22 | Filing |
| Officer | $195.84 | 1,101 | $215,619.84 | 214,034 | 2025-10-22 | Filing |
| Officer | $194.65 | 1,199 | $233,385.35 | 215,135 | 2025-10-22 | Filing |
| Officer | $193.66 | 1,100 | $213,026.00 | 216,334 | 2025-10-22 | Filing |
| Officer | $192.44 | 1,100 | $211,684.00 | 217,434 | 2025-10-22 | Filing |
| Large Shareholder, Officer, Director | $202.41 | 28 | $5,667.48 | 494,104 | 2025-10-15 | Filing |
| Large Shareholder, Officer, Director | $201.67 | 3,913 | $789,134.71 | 494,132 | 2025-10-15 | Filing |
| Large Shareholder, Officer, Director | $200.81 | 6,436 | $1,292,413.16 | 498,045 | 2025-10-15 | Filing |
| Large Shareholder, Officer, Director | $199.97 | 6,623 | $1,324,401.31 | 504,481 | 2025-10-15 | Filing |
| Large Shareholder, Officer, Director | $198.88 | 400 | $79,552.00 | 511,104 | 2025-10-15 | Filing |
| Large Shareholder, Officer, Director | $197.34 | 600 | $118,404.00 | 511,504 | 2025-10-15 | Filing |
| Officer | $205.43 | 400 | $82,172.00 | 206,534 | 2025-10-08 | Filing |
| Officer | $204.25 | 100 | $20,425.00 | 206,934 | 2025-10-08 | Filing |
| Officer | $203.00 | 100 | $20,300.00 | 207,034 | 2025-10-08 | Filing |
| Officer | $202.30 | 4,522 | $914,800.60 | 207,134 | 2025-10-08 | Filing |
| Officer | $201.50 | 4,413 | $889,219.50 | 211,656 | 2025-10-08 | Filing |
| Officer | $200.10 | 500 | $100,050.00 | 216,069 | 2025-10-08 | Filing |